What are gynecological diseases?

Diseases of the female reproductive system are collectively referred to as gynecological diseases, because gynecological diseases include many types, including vaginal diseases, vulvar diseases, uterine diseases, etc., and there are also many common adnexitis and ovarian inflammation. Diseases of these organs are also included in gynecological diseases. Diseases of the female reproductive system are called gynecological diseases.

Gynecological diseases include vulvar diseases, vaginal diseases, uterine diseases, fallopian tube diseases, ovarian diseases, etc. Gynecological diseases are common and frequently occurring diseases among women.

However, since many people lack the proper understanding of gynecological diseases and lack of physical health care, coupled with various bad living habits, their physical condition is deteriorating, resulting in some women being plagued by diseases that cannot be cured for a long time, causing great inconvenience to their normal life and work.
